Bhua Ek Te Fufad Do is like a quirky blend of comedy and drama that really taps into the Punjabi spirit. The film, directed by Hadev Tohra, unfolds with a mix of laughter and poignant moments, showcasing the lives of its characters. The pacing feels just right, giving enough room for comedic beats without losing the emotional undercurrents. Amrit Alam and the ensemble cast deliver performances that feel genuine, drawing you into their world. It's got this unique atmosphere, a sort of light-heartedness that still manages to touch on deeper themes of family and relationships. The practical effects, though modest, add to its charm, allowing the story to shine rather than technical flair. It's definitely one of those films that sticks with you in its own subtle way.
